Picture window replacement services involve removing existing large, fixed-pane windows and installing new ones to improve both the appearance and functionality of a home. These services typically include measuring the opening, selecting suitable replacement windows, and carefully installing them to ensure a proper fit. Homeowners can choose from a variety of styles, materials, and designs to match their home's aesthetic and meet practical needs, such as increased natural light or better energy efficiency.
This service helps address several common problems faced by homeowners. Over time, windows can become drafty, cracked, or difficult to open and close, leading to higher energy bills and reduced comfort. Damaged or outdated windows may also compromise security or allow excessive noise from outside. Replacing windows with larger, clearer, or more modern options can enhance a home's overall comfort, security, and curb appeal, making it a worthwhile upgrade for many property owners.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or picture window repairs range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es fall within this range, depending on the window size and the extent of the damage. Larger or more complex repairs may cost more.
Standard Replacement - Replacing a standard-sized picture window us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Local contractors often handle these projects within this range, with some variations based on materials and installation requirements.
Full Window Replacement - Complete replacement of multiple or larger picture windows can range from $3,500 to $8,000. These projects are common for homes upgrading multiple units or installing high-end styles, though some may reach higher costs for premium options.
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Large, custom, or complex picture window installations can exceed $8,000 and may go beyond $15,000. Such projects are less frequent and often involve specialized materials or unique architectural features, leading to higher cost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
